What Is CoolMen?

CoolMen is an electronic testicular cooling device that uses active temperature control and smartphone connectivity. It's designed to normalize testicular temperature through controlled cooling, with a companion mobile app that tracks therapy sessions and monitors progress.

The device uses sensors and a precise electronic control system to maintain a target temperature, transmitting data to a mobile app for therapy supervision. It's positioned as a medical-grade fertility tool for men dealing with heat-related infertility.

Key CoolMen features:

  • Electronic active cooling (not ice-based)
  • Smartphone app with temperature monitoring
  • Controlled temperature regulation to prevent over-cooling
  • Designed for daily sitting/desk use
  • Medical/clinical positioning

The Sauna Problem: Why Electronic Cooling Doesn't Work in High Heat

Here's the fundamental issue: CoolMen is an electronic device designed for controlled, room-temperature environments. It works by actively cooling to offset the mild heat increase from sitting at a desk or driving.

Saunas operate at 70-100°C (158-212°F).That's not a mild temperature increase — it's an extreme thermal assault on your body. An electronic cooling device that's calibrated for desk use simply cannot keep up with the intense, sustained heat of a sauna session.

Ice packs, on the other hand, are nature's thermal battery. The phase-change process of ice melting absorbs enormous amounts of energy, which is why IcedBallz can maintain effective cooling for 45-60 minutes even in extreme sauna heat.
